fre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的二氧化碳濃度器設(shè)計(jì)論文-資料下載頁(yè)

2025-06-26 17:20本頁(yè)面
  

【正文】 ,并已對(duì)數(shù)據(jù)進(jìn)行了采樣并作了處理。它輸出的電壓信號(hào)與二氧化碳濃度值呈線性關(guān)系,輸出的電壓信號(hào)為0~,相當(dāng)于0~3000ppm的二氧化碳濃度。AM4模塊的輸出電壓為0~3V,需要經(jīng)過放大處理變?yōu)?~5V傳送給A/D轉(zhuǎn)化器,才能為單片機(jī)傳送更為準(zhǔn)確的數(shù)字信號(hào)。本設(shè)計(jì)對(duì)處理該信號(hào)方案如圖63所示。 報(bào)警模塊設(shè)計(jì)若溫室大棚二氧化碳濃度參數(shù)超標(biāo)時(shí),則啟動(dòng)聲光報(bào)警電路,同時(shí)單片機(jī)通過控制固態(tài)繼電器來(lái)打開相應(yīng)的執(zhí)行機(jī)構(gòu),工作人員也可以根據(jù)此情況來(lái)查看相應(yīng)的區(qū)域或者采取相應(yīng)的措施。 報(bào)警電路介紹 報(bào)警電路中光報(bào)警采用發(fā)光二極管,聲報(bào)警采用蜂鳴器來(lái)設(shè)計(jì),采用兩個(gè)引腳控制。其中,蜂鳴器電路中,9013三極管起開關(guān)作用,輸出高電平時(shí),管腳輸出電壓VOH==,輸出電流I=1mA,經(jīng)過2K限流電阻R分壓后,使得三極管發(fā)射結(jié)正偏,集電結(jié)反偏,晶體管導(dǎo)通,蜂鳴器上電而產(chǎn)生報(bào)警聲。對(duì)與發(fā)光二極管,必須采用限流電阻,否則會(huì)是二極管電流過大而燒壞。,即可實(shí)現(xiàn)聲光報(bào)警。其硬件電路如圖71所示。圖71 聲光報(bào)警電路 LED顯示模塊設(shè)計(jì)顯示模塊包括兩個(gè)部分:第一部分為由4個(gè)LED組成的數(shù)碼顯示電路,用于顯示測(cè)量的二氧化碳濃度。第二部分為由3個(gè)發(fā)光二極管組成的顯示電路,用于顯示光照條件的高低。 數(shù)碼管顯示原理本設(shè)計(jì)的顯示模塊采用了4片LED八段數(shù)碼管,關(guān)于八段數(shù)碼管的顯示方式主要有兩種,分別是靜態(tài)顯示方式和動(dòng)態(tài)顯示方式。兩種顯示方式各有各的優(yōu)缺點(diǎn),由于本設(shè)計(jì)中軟件設(shè)計(jì)中語(yǔ)句較多,加置采用擴(kuò)展芯片來(lái)驅(qū)動(dòng)顯示電路,采用動(dòng)態(tài)顯示會(huì)由閃耀感,會(huì)造成顯示不正常,故采用靜態(tài)顯示。靜態(tài)顯示接口是單片機(jī)中應(yīng)用最為廣泛的一種顯示方式。靜態(tài)顯示的特點(diǎn)是每個(gè)數(shù)碼管的段選必須接一個(gè)8位數(shù)據(jù)線來(lái)保持顯示的字形碼。當(dāng)送入一次字形碼后,顯示字形可一直保持,直到送入新字形碼為止。這種方法的優(yōu)點(diǎn)是占用CPU時(shí)間少,顯示便于監(jiān)測(cè)和控制。缺點(diǎn)是硬件電路比較復(fù)雜,成本較高。數(shù)碼顯示電路。本設(shè)計(jì)共用到4個(gè)八段數(shù)碼管,用于顯示4位當(dāng)前二氧化碳濃度值,并且可更具鍵盤輸入要求顯示前兩次的濃度值,采用靜態(tài)顯示方法設(shè)計(jì)電路。由于本設(shè)計(jì)元件較多,I/O比較緊張,所以采用鎖存器74LS373鎖存地址,以鎖存數(shù)碼管的段碼,這樣采用一個(gè)I/O口即可驅(qū)動(dòng)4位數(shù)碼管。經(jīng)過74LS373鎖存后的段碼信號(hào),不足以點(diǎn)亮數(shù)碼管,所以必須采用驅(qū)動(dòng)器經(jīng)行驅(qū)動(dòng)。在本設(shè)計(jì)中采用8路反向驅(qū)動(dòng)器ULA2803來(lái)驅(qū)動(dòng)數(shù)碼管。顯示電路如圖81所示。圖81 數(shù)碼顯示電路鎖存器74LS373的鎖存信號(hào)由單片機(jī)控制,、。單片機(jī)信號(hào)不足以使鎖存器鎖住信號(hào),經(jīng)過信號(hào)處理電路處理后,才可以正常鎖存。當(dāng)單片機(jī)送出低電平信號(hào),經(jīng)過三極管與反相器,傳送入鎖存器,使鎖存器導(dǎo)通,經(jīng)行段碼的讀??;當(dāng)單片機(jī)送出高電平,經(jīng)過三極管放大,在經(jīng)過反相器,使鎖存器得到足夠低的鎖存信號(hào),使之前所存取的段碼信號(hào)得以鎖存。鎖存器控制電路如圖82所示。圖82顯示電路鎖存器控制電路 發(fā)光二極管顯示電路發(fā)光二極管顯示電路,用于顯示光照條件的強(qiáng)弱。當(dāng)三個(gè)發(fā)光二極管同時(shí)點(diǎn)亮,代表是晴天;當(dāng)有兩個(gè)點(diǎn)亮,代表是陰天;當(dāng)只有一個(gè)點(diǎn)亮,代表是黑天。電路如圖83所示。圖83發(fā)光二極管顯示電路 A/D轉(zhuǎn)換電路模塊設(shè)計(jì) AD7705 是十六位分辨率的A/D 轉(zhuǎn)換器,兩通道全差分模擬輸入,使用+5V 單電源,主要應(yīng)用于低頻測(cè)量。它利用了Σ△轉(zhuǎn)換技術(shù)實(shí)現(xiàn)了16位無(wú)誤碼數(shù)據(jù)輸出,三線數(shù)字接口,可以通過串行輸入接口,由軟件配置芯片的增益值、輸入信號(hào)極性和數(shù)據(jù)更新速率,非常靈活方便。具有自校準(zhǔn)和系統(tǒng)校準(zhǔn)功能,能夠消除器件本身和系統(tǒng)的增益以及偏移誤差。是用于開發(fā)智能系統(tǒng)、微控制器系統(tǒng)和基于DSP 系統(tǒng)的理想產(chǎn)品。 AD7705 簡(jiǎn)介 AD7705二全差分輸入通道的ADC ,十六位無(wú)丟失代碼, %非線性;可編程增益:1~128 ;三線串行接口;具有模擬輸入端緩沖器;工作電壓: ~~5. 25V;低功耗,3V 電壓時(shí), 最大功耗為1mW;等待電流的最大值為8μA; 16 腳DIP、SOIC和TSSOP 封裝。引腳功能如下: SCLK:串行時(shí)鐘輸入。將一個(gè)外部的串行時(shí)鐘加于這一輸入端口,以訪問 TM7705 的串V行數(shù)據(jù)。 2 、MCLK IN:為轉(zhuǎn)換器提供主時(shí)鐘信號(hào)。能以晶振或外部時(shí)鐘的形式提供。晶振可以接在MCLK IN 和MCLK OUT 二引腳之間。此外,MCLK IN 也可用CMOS 兼容的時(shí)鐘驅(qū)動(dòng),而MCLK OUT 不連接。時(shí)鐘頻率的范圍為500kHz~5MHz。 MCLK OUT:當(dāng)主時(shí)鐘為晶振時(shí),晶振在MCLK IN 和MCLK OUT之間。如果在MCLK IN 引腳處接上一個(gè)外部時(shí)鐘,MCLK OUT 將提供一個(gè)反相時(shí)鐘信號(hào)。這個(gè)時(shí)鐘可以用來(lái)為外部電路提供時(shí)鐘源,且可以驅(qū)動(dòng)一個(gè)CMOS負(fù)載。如果用戶不需要,MCLK OUT 可以通過時(shí)鐘寄存器中的CLK DIS 位關(guān)掉。這樣,器件不會(huì)在MCLK OUT 腳上驅(qū)動(dòng)電容負(fù)載而消耗不必要的功率 CS:片選,低電平有效的邏輯輸入,選擇TM7705。將該引腳接為低電平,TM7705 能以三線接口模式運(yùn)行(以SCLK、DIN 和DOUT 與器件接口)。 5 RESET:復(fù)位輸入。低電平有效的輸入,將器件的控制邏輯、接口邏輯、校準(zhǔn)系數(shù)、數(shù)字濾波器和模擬調(diào)制器復(fù)位至上電狀態(tài)AIN2(+):差分模擬輸入通道2 的正輸入端。AIN1(+):差分模擬輸入通道1 的正輸入端。AIN1():差分模擬輸入通道1 的負(fù)輸入端;REF IN(+):差分基準(zhǔn)輸入的正輸入端?;鶞?zhǔn)輸入是差分的,并規(guī)定REF IN(+)必須大于REF IN()。REFIN(+)可以取VDD 和GND 之間的任何值。 REF IN():差分基準(zhǔn)輸入的負(fù)輸入端。REF IN()可以取VDD 和GND 之間的任何值,且滿足REF IN(+)大于REF IN()。1AIN2():差分模擬輸入通道2 的負(fù)輸入端。1DRDY:DRDY邏輯低電平表示可從TM7705 的數(shù)據(jù)寄存器獲取新的輸出字。完成對(duì)一個(gè)完全的輸出字的讀操作后,DRDY 引腳立即回到高電平。1DOUT:串行數(shù)據(jù)輸出端。從片內(nèi)的輸出移位寄存器讀出的串行數(shù)據(jù)由此端輸出。1DIN:串行數(shù)據(jù)輸入端。向片內(nèi)的輸入移位寄存器寫入的串行數(shù)據(jù)由此輸入。 AD7705與單片機(jī)的接口電路1VDD:電源電壓,+~+1GND:內(nèi)部電路的地電位基準(zhǔn)點(diǎn) AD7705轉(zhuǎn)換電路 AD7705 的串行接口包括5 個(gè)信號(hào):即CS 、SCLK、DIN 、DOUT 和DRDY 。DIN線用來(lái)向片內(nèi)寄存器傳輸數(shù)據(jù),而DOUT 線用來(lái)訪問寄存器里的數(shù)據(jù)。SCLK 是串行時(shí)鐘輸入,所有的數(shù)據(jù)傳輸都和SCLK 信號(hào)有關(guān)。DRDY 線作為狀態(tài)信號(hào),以提示數(shù)據(jù)什么時(shí)候已準(zhǔn)備好從寄存器讀數(shù)據(jù)。在一般的簡(jiǎn)單系統(tǒng)中,常常只有1 片AD7705 或其它共用口線的器件,故CS 通常接低電平,節(jié)省了單片機(jī)的輸出輸入控制線,這樣就可以配置成三線連接方式。三線連接方式下決定數(shù)據(jù)寄存器是否被更新也即是確定數(shù)據(jù)寄存器是否可以被讀,只有通過查詢通信寄存器DRDY 位來(lái)判斷,這種做法的代價(jià)是時(shí)間開銷較多,它并不適用于實(shí)時(shí)性要求比較強(qiáng)的系統(tǒng)。比較好的辦法是監(jiān)控硬件DRDY 引腳的狀態(tài),以決定數(shù)據(jù)寄存器是否被更新,硬件DRDY 引腳的輸出與通信寄存器DRDY 位同步,DRDY 引腳一旦變成低電平,表明數(shù)據(jù)寄存器數(shù)據(jù)已經(jīng)更新,可以讀取。所以DRDY 輸出引腳接至CPU 的INT0 或INT1 就可以實(shí)現(xiàn)中斷或者查詢方式的監(jiān)控。但不管是查詢方式還是中斷方式,都需要增加一根數(shù)據(jù)線。 AD7705轉(zhuǎn)換電路 片內(nèi)寄存器AD7705 包含了8 個(gè)片內(nèi)寄存器,這些寄存器通過器件的串行口訪問,所有的操作都是通過對(duì)寄存器的操作。第一個(gè)是通信寄存器,器件復(fù)位后,通信寄存器處于等待狀態(tài),通過通信寄存器寫操作,決定下一次操作是寫還是讀,同時(shí)決定這一次讀操作或?qū)懖僮靼l(fā)生在那個(gè)寄存器上。也就是說(shuō)所有的寄存器(包括通信寄存器本身和輸出數(shù)據(jù)寄存器)進(jìn)行讀操作之前,必須首先寫通信寄存器,然后才能讀選定的寄存器。下面簡(jiǎn)單介紹寄存器的功能。通信寄存器 (RSRSRS0 = 0、0、0)設(shè)置寄存器(RSRSRS0 = 0、0、1);上電/復(fù)位狀態(tài):01Hex時(shí)鐘寄存器(RSRSRS0 = 0、0);上電/復(fù)位狀態(tài):05Hex數(shù)據(jù)寄存器 (RSRSRS0 = 0、1)
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1